Constructing a Rhombus with a Given Base

Construction Algorithm
1 Construct a line AB as a given base of the rhombus.
2 Construct the line BC so that AB = BC.
3 Define a translation from B to C. (Use menu item "Mode/Transformation/Translation" then select B as a peimage point and select C as an image point to generate the translation button [B to C].
4 Select the line AB and the two points A and B as well then press the translation button [B to C] to construct the image of the line AB by the defined translation.
5 Join up the four points A, B, C and D to get the required rhombus.
6 Switch to drag mode. Pick a free element. Move it around to check your construction.
Construction Theorems
A rhombus is a parallelogram in which two adjacent sides are equal in length.

Translation preserves the parallelism and the distance between points.
